ASP.NET Web Service example
This Code is a .asmx file. This is the ASP.NET file extension for XML
Web Services.
The only difference from a normal application is that this function is
defined as a "WebMethod".
Use "WebMethod" to mark the functions in your application that you
would like to make into web services.
The ASP.NET has automatically created a WSDL and SOAP
request.

The XML Basics
eXtensible Markup Language (XML) is a super set of HTML. A user can define his /her own tags in XML.
Any XML documents must conform their metadata such as Document Type Definition (DTD) or Schema which specifies complex data types, elements and its attributes, and its sub-elements, etc.
A XML document is a universal format document typeused for data exchange and data storage. XML is also widely used for deployment descriptors and configuration specifications.

HTML vs XML
HTML is a language specifically designed for displaying information in browser. It doesn’t carry information about the structure of the content held within its page.
XML (Extensible MarkUp Language) is a language used to represent data in a form that does not rely on any particular proprietary technology. It uses user-defined tags to give meaningful names to data elements. With XML, we separate the data content from the data presentation.

The XML Basics (cont.)
Since the DTD itself does not use XML syntax and is not
very flexible. Schema is getting more and more popular
now and is replacing DTD because schema itself is in
XML format.
A XML Schema Document (XSD) is a metadata of a XML
document. XSD specifies the syntax, structure, and
constraints in a corresponding XML including datatype or
complex datatype of elements, attributes of elements.

The XML Basics (cont.)
The sequence tag in XSD Schema specifies the order and the
occurrence of sub-elements in their parent element. In this example
name and gpa elements are the sub-elements of the student
element which in turn is an element of the students element.
Of course there may be many students in a students set. The
XMLNS plays a same role as package in Java and namespace in
C++ to prevent naming collisions.
An element name can be qualified with a namespace prefix with a
colon symbol “:”. The idea of combining a namespace URI with a
local name is to make any identifier name in XML universally
unique.

WSDL Parts
Types Used to define custom message types
Messages Abstraction of request and response messages that my client and
service need to communicate.
PortTypes Contains a set of operations.
Operations organize WSDL messages.
Bindings Binds the PortType to a specific protocol (typically SOAP over
http).
You can bind one PortType to several different protocols by using more than one port.
Services Gives you one or more URLs for the service.

Simple Object Access Protocol (SOAP)
SOAP is an XML based message exchange protocol specified by
the W3C specification.
SOAP is also a lightweight protocol working in a distributed
heterogeneous environment. Some people simply say that SOAP
= HTTP + XML since SOAP message is an XML-document but it
conforms to a specific XML Schema.
SOAP is used to specify the format of a request and response in
the Web service computing to get and send message via HTTP
port by HTTP POST method.
Se
rvic
e O
rien
ted
Arc
hite
ctu
re
43SOA Workshop: A. Mahjoorian , Session 4 .... System Co.
SOAP (cont.)
Every SOAP message has a required envelope and a message
body. A SOAP envelope identifies an XML document as a SOAP
message.
A SOAP envelope element must have one sub-element which is the
Body element. A Body element of a SOAP message can be data
itself, a name of method be invoked, arguments of the method be
invoked, a SOAP request message, or return results from a SOAP
response message.
A SOAP envelope may also have a header sub element but it is
optional. A header element just gives more metadata about the
message.

BPEL Overview
History of BPEL
BPEL emerged as a convergence of language features from
IBM's Web Service Flow Language (WSFL) and Microsoft's
XLANG
BPEL 1.0 was jointly developed by IBM, BEA, SAP, Siebel, and
Microsoft in August 2002
BPEL 1.1 was submitted to OASIS in April 2003
Currently, it is the process of finalising the standard specification,
namely WS-BPEL 2.0
BPEL Engines
BEA WebLogics, IBM WebSphere, Microsoft BizTalk, SAP XI,
Oracle BPEL Process Manager, and ActiveBPEL

Basic Activities
Invoke: invoking an operation on some Web service
Receive: waiting for a message from an external partner
Reply: replying to an external partner
Wait: pausing for a certain period of time
Assign: copying data from one place to another
Throw : indicating errors in the execution
Compensate: undoing the effects of already completed activities
Exit: terminating the entire service instance
Empty: doing nothing

Control Links
Control links are a non-structural construct defined in BPEL
A control link denotes a conditional transition between two activities
Notions related to control links A transition condition (associated with a control link) is a boolean
expression over the process variables
A join condition (associated with an activity) is a boolean expression in terms of tokens carried by incoming control links to the activity

Compensation
Compensation refers to application-specific activities that
attempt to undo the already completed actions
A compensation handler is defined for a scope, and
specifies the actions need to be taken for the
compensation of the scope
A compensate activity is used to invoke the
compensation of an inner scope, i.e., its occurrence
triggers the compensation handler associated with that
scope

UDDI
The Web service provider can register their Web services at these UDDI registries and Web service requester can lookup a specificWeb service by its provider name (business name), category info, Web service name, or even by the keys of them if requester knows.
A Web service provider actually registers a WSDL (web Service Description Language) interface at UDDI registry which is a contract interface of the Web service to be used by its client.
Both UDDI query requests and UDDI query results are in the SOAPformats.

UDDI
A Web service provider must publish/register its services with a Universal Description, Discovery, and Integration (UDDI) registry so that it can be accessed by any Web services requester globally.
It just looks like a phonebook where all businesses register their phones there for customers to lookup services. A customer must lookup the phonebook either on-line or by phonebook unless a customer knows the phone number before.
A Web service can also be reached without any assistance from UDDI if the Web service client knows the contact information such as Web service’s URL, name of method, argument signature of the method including types of return value.
